Basantpur

Basantpur is a village located in Dongargarh tehsil of Rajnandgaon district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 24km away from sub-district headquarter Dongargarh (tehsildar office) and 22km away from district headquarter Rajnandgaon. As per 2009 stats, Saltikari is the gram panchayat of Basantpur village.

About Basantp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Basantpur is 440560. The village spans a total geographical area of 218.06 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 491445. Dongargarh is nearest town to Basantp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 24km away.

Population of Basantpur

According to the 2011 Census, Basantpur has a total population of about 453, with approximately 232 males and 221 females. The sex ratio is around 952 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 75 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 175 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 15. The overall literacy rate is approximately 55.85%, with male literacy at about 62.50% and female literacy near 48.87%. There are around 86 households in the village. Connectivity of Basantp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Basantpur. As per the 2011 stats, Basantp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
